Several cases of infant botulism have been linked to a recall of ByHeart Whole Nutrition Infant Formula , according to health officials. The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) announced the voluntary recall of two specific lots of the formula after 13 infants from 10 states were hospitalized with botulism symptoms. The affected states include Arizona, California, Illinois, Minnesota, New Jersey, Oregon, Pennsylvania, Rhode Island, Texas, and Washington.
The recall, initiated by ByHeart, comes amid an ongoing investigation by the FDA ,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), and state health departments.
